What is Sea Lily?
Sea Lily (Pancratium maritimum) is a plant that grows naturally on the dunes of the Mediterranean coast. To survive in this environment particularly exposed to UV rays and oxidative stress, it produces various bioactive compounds that contribute to its protection. In cosmetics, its extract is studied for its ability to target the mechanisms responsible for skin pigmentation. It helps regulate melanin production to promote a more even and luminous complexion.

Where does Sea Lily come from?
Sea Lily is a bulbous plant found on the beaches of the Mediterranean basin and Atlantic coasts. Resilient against the harshest climatic conditions, it is capable of thriving in poor, sandy soils with high sun exposure. The extract used in cosmetics is obtained from controlled cultivation in order to preserve the wild populations of this species, which is protected in several countries.
Properties and Active Principles of Sea Lily
Sea Lily naturally contains several compounds of interest for the skin, notably polyphenols and specific alkaloids.
These molecules endow it with several properties:
- Helping regulate the mechanisms involved in melanin synthesis,
- Assisting in preventing the appearance of dark spots,
- Contributing to complexion evenness,
- Protecting the skin from oxidative stress thanks to its antioxidant activity,
- Helping preserve the skin's natural radiance.

Any side effects?
Sea Lily is generally well tolerated when used at the concentrations recommended in cosmetics. Available studies report a good safety profile and excellent compatibility with sensitive skin. As with any plant extract, an individual reaction remains possible, though rare.

Is Sea Lily a skin-bleaching ingredient?
No. It does not depigment the skin. It helps regulate melanin production to limit the appearance of new pigment irregularities and promote a more even complexion.
Can it be used all year round?
Yes. It can be used daily, regardless of the season. However, sun protection remains essential to prevent UV-induced dark spots.
Is it suitable for sensitive skin?
Yes. Available data show good skin tolerance, including on sensitive skin.
